A biscuit joiner is a handy tool, which you can use to make grooves of different sizes on wood and wood panels so that you can join them together using a biscuit.

The most standard biscuit sizes are 0, 10 and 20 so the joiner you buy must have those as one-touch stops.

Also, a joiner should have a fence system to set the angles you desire to cut. You should get a corded or battery-powered biscuit joiner as these are the standard power sources.

How to Buy the Best Biscuit Joiner

How to Buy the Best Biscuit Joiner

Photo: DeWalt

1. Power

Power is a critical aspect of your biscuit joiner because it is what drives the system’s core functionality, which is cutting biscuit groves in your wood.

Therefore, the ideal joiner should have enough power to push its blade into the wood fast, efficiently, and accurately.

For corded joiners, you can expect power outputs of up to 8.5 amps at 120 volts of AC power. Battery joiners are equally powerful, so you shouldn’t shy away from them.

Speed is also an important measure of power so even as you focus on power output, don’t forget to check the motor’s revolutions per minute (RPM) to determine what speed is ideal for your woodwork tasks.

2. Power Source

From our review, we noted that the most common biscuit joiners are electric-powered. This type of power source is reliable, efficient, quiet, and clean. You will not be polluting the environment with this electric tool.

Battery-powered biscuit joiners are also equally effective and sometimes superior to their corded rivals depending on the power output.

It’s worth noting that if you opt for a battery-powered biscuit joiner, it will likely cost you more than an electric corded one.

This price difference is probably because a battery-powered model is portable unlike the corded on, which will only work if it is plugged to a power outlet. 

3. Blade

Blade versatility is critical to the success of your biscuit joiner in delivering on its promise of efficiency, speed, and accuracy.

The standard blade diameter observed in all the models we reviewed is 4 inches. This size is preferred because it is the most widely used.

4-inch blades are suitable for a range of biscuit sizes including #0, #10 and #20, which are the most common.

You can also get a biscuit joiner with a plunge mechanism, which accommodates smaller blades if you need them.

Most blades use standard materials such as steel, which is durable and sturdy for both light and heavy-duty cutting.

4. Speed

Whether your biscuit joiner is corded or battery-powered, it is going to be powered by a motor.

The motor is responsible for rotating the blade, whose speed is measured in revolutions per minute (RPM).

Most of the models we reviewed have a speed ranging between 10,000 and 12,000 RPM. This speed is more than adequate for delivering fast and precise cuts through your wood.

Although some of the fastest joiners we reviewed are very expensive, this is not always the case.

Fast motors do not necessarily have to cost a lot of money, so it is possible to get an affordable biscuit joiner that will deliver superior speeds.

5. Dust collection

Dust collection is a concern for many biscuit joiner users because this feature enables them to control and contain the amount of dirt produced by their tools.

If dust collection is a priority for you, then get a model with features such as a dust port, and a dust bag, both of which aid in dust collection and disposal. Not all the models on our list have this feature.

Another reason you’d want to go for a joiner with these features is that dust is highly obstructive. When it accumulates, it can obstruct your view when using the tool. Hence, dust collection capabilities may prove highly useful for eliminating this challenge.

6. Fence System

The fence system is one of the most important components of your biscuit joiner. It is responsible for setting different angles you can apply to your biscuit grooves.

We noted that most fences have an adjustable angle at positive stops of 0, 45, and 90 degrees. Some can tilt even more, up to 135 degrees. These angles are the most common, especially when joining wood panels.

This system needs to be accurate so that you make precise cuts otherwise any slight inaccuracy can lead to wastage of resources or misaligned grooves.

Fence systems should also be easy to adjust.

7. Ease of use

The ease of using your fence is determined by a combination of factors, but the most important include the power source, power output, grip, and handling.

If your biscuit joiner is corded, like many of the models we reviewed, you can be assured of a powerful and fast tool that will get the job done within no time.

The main issue with corded joiners, however, is that their flexibility and portability is limited by the cord’s length.

A battery-powered joiner, on the other hand, offers more flexibility because you can move with it over long distances.

As for handling, most models have comfortable and firm grips combined with ergonomic designs that will make the tools easy to use.
